Transaction ef6aa71579abcbdab99793266da0452d981769d273fa3d2270d27fae99319395
1 Input
1 Output
-
ef6aa71579abcbdab99793266da0452d981769d273fa3d2270d27fae99319395:0
- value
- 17549129
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a697dbc30c13e42ed68da146bccfbfc6b0515690 OP_EQUAL
- address
- 3Gst1hQ5xVUC9um91SANtX1BsbXbvhFNtj